Image-based particle size distribution

Measure individual particle dimensions from microscopy or SEM images to build size distributions. ConductVision segments individual particles even in aggregated samples, measuring equivalent diameter, aspect ratio, and generating D10/D50/D90 statistics.

Features

What You Get

Aggregate Separation

AI separates touching and overlapping particles for accurate individual measurements

Distribution Statistics

Automatic D10, D50, D90, span, and custom percentile calculations

Standards Compliance

Analysis methods align with ISO 13322-1 image-based particle sizing standards

Diameter Histogram

Equivalent circular diameters binned with standard half-open intervals, so every particle lands in exactly one bin

Fitted Normal Curve

A Gaussian is overlaid on the histogram when the data supports it, with the 1, 2, and 3 sigma spread called out

Border Object Handling

Objects touching the image edge are excluded from statistics by default because their area is incomplete, and can be re-included when needed
